Output 187d3d98679f77ff1b8f7099592a70a34d483d6c98b0fffa6165aa3ffc42914e:1

value
692810458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a9934bd87a783cd0f28d0d3b81ba4aad2fc477 OP_EQUAL
address
3FhWTCQdCbe7XYANoJZcpjtQbXWJSZ7CuU
transaction
187d3d98679f77ff1b8f7099592a70a34d483d6c98b0fffa6165aa3ffc42914e
spent
true